| Steel columns raised the structure to a little over 381 metres.
One World Trade Center has become New York's tallest building, overtaking the Empire State Building, after a steel column was lifted into place.
The installation of the column on the 100th floor of the skyscraper makes the structure at the site of the 9/11 attacks 1,271ft (387m) high.
The building, construction of which began in April 2006, will be 1,776ft tall when completed.
The World Trade Center's twin towers were destroyed on 11 September 2001.
The skyscraper, dubbed Freedom Tower, became the tallest building in New York a day before the one-year anniversary of the operation that killed Osama Bin Laden.
